#30958e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#30958e is composed of 18.8% red, 58.4%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 4.7%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 175.8 degrees, a saturation of 51.3% and a lightness of 38.6%. #30958e color hex could be obtained by blending #60ffff with #002b1d.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#30958e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1fafa is the lightest one.

Tones of #30958e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5d6867 is the less saturated color, while #03c2b5 is the most saturated one.
